Methods for Using a Laptop as a Monitor

Employing an HDMI Capture Card

An HDMI capture card is a device that allows you to input video and audio signals from an external source into your computer. Think of it as a bridge that enables your laptop to receive video input just like a standard monitor. It works by converting the HDMI signal from your main computer (or any HDMI output device) into a format your laptop can understand and display.

Here’s a breakdown of the steps:

  • Required Equipment: You will need an HDMI capture card (choose one based on your budget and desired resolution), an HDMI cable to connect your main computer to the capture card, and potentially another HDMI cable to connect the capture card to your laptop.
  • Connecting the Devices: Connect one end of the HDMI cable to the HDMI output port on your primary computer (the one whose display you want to extend) and the other end to the HDMI input port on the HDMI capture card. Then, connect the capture card to your laptop using a USB cable (most capture cards are powered via USB).
  • Software Setup: You’ll need to install software that can capture and display the video feed from the HDMI capture card. Popular options include OBS Studio (free and open-source), XSplit Broadcaster, and other video capture software. Most capture cards come with their own dedicated software.
  • Configuring the Software: Open your chosen software and select the HDMI capture card as the video source. You may need to adjust settings like resolution and frame rate to match the output of your main computer. Configure the software to display the input in full-screen mode on your laptop’s display.

Pros: An HDMI capture card provides good compatibility with various devices. You can use laptop as computer monitor for gaming consoles, other computers, streaming devices, and more.

Cons: Latency, or delay, can be an issue with HDMI capture cards. While modern cards have minimized this, it’s still something to consider. The cost of the capture card is also an investment. To minimize latency, ensure your drivers are up-to-date, close unnecessary applications on your laptop, and use a capture card designed for low-latency performance.

Using Remote Desktop Software (Windows)

Windows Remote Desktop allows you to remotely access and control one computer from another over a network. This is a simple and effective way to use laptop as computer monitor, especially if both computers are running Windows.

  • Enabling Remote Desktop: On the computer you want to mirror (the host computer), search for “Remote Desktop settings” in the Windows search bar. Enable “Remote Desktop.” Make sure you have a user account with a password set up on the host computer. Take note of the computer name of the host, you may need this later.
  • Finding the IP Address: On the host computer, open Command Prompt (type “cmd” in the search bar). Type ipconfig and press Enter. Look for “IPv4 Address.” This is the IP address you’ll need to connect from your laptop.
  • Connecting from the Laptop: On your laptop (the client computer), search for “Remote Desktop Connection” in the Windows search bar and open it. Enter the IP address of the host computer. If prompted, enter the computer name you took note of earlier. Enter the username and password for an account on the host computer.
  • Configuration Options: Within the Remote Desktop Connection settings, you can adjust the screen resolution, audio settings, and other preferences to optimize the experience.

Pros: This method requires no additional hardware if you’re using the built-in Remote Desktop feature. It’s convenient for remote access and control, allowing you to use laptop as computer monitor and also control the other computer.

Cons: A stable network connection is essential. You may experience lag, particularly with demanding applications. Security is also a concern; enable Network Level Authentication (NLA) in the Remote Desktop settings on the host computer for enhanced security.

Using Third-Party Screen Sharing Apps

Numerous third-party applications are designed to facilitate screen sharing, allowing you to use laptop as computer monitor easily. Spacedesk and SuperDisplay are popular examples. These apps typically work by installing software on both the main computer and the laptop and connecting them over a Wi-Fi network.

  • Downloading and Installing: Download and install the screen sharing app on both your main computer and your laptop. Follow the on-screen instructions during installation.
  • Connecting the Devices: Open the app on both devices. The app on your laptop will typically scan for available devices on the network. Select your main computer from the list. You may need to grant permissions on both devices for the connection to be established.
  • Configuring the Display: Once connected, you can adjust the display settings on your main computer to treat the laptop as a second monitor. This includes extending the display, mirroring the display, or using the laptop as the primary display.

Pros: These apps are often easier to set up than Remote Desktop. Some offer additional features like touch input on the laptop screen.

Cons: Performance relies heavily on the stability of your Wi-Fi network. Software bugs and compatibility issues can occur. Some apps may have limitations on screen resolution or refresh rate, and premium features may require a subscription.

Utilizing Dedicated Wired Monitor Software

Software like Deskreen or TwomonUSB are specifically designed to turn your laptop into a wired monitor. They establish a direct connection via USB, providing a more stable and faster connection compared to wireless options.

  • Downloading and Installing: Download and install the software on both your primary PC and the laptop you want to use laptop as computer monitor.
  • Connecting via USB: Connect the two devices using a USB cable.
  • Configuration: Launch the software on both devices and follow the on-screen prompts to configure the display settings. You can choose to extend or mirror your display onto the laptop screen.

Pros: Wired connections offer better performance and stability compared to Wi-Fi. This reduces lag and provides a smoother experience, especially for demanding applications.

Cons: Requires a USB cable connection, limiting mobility compared to wireless solutions. The software might not be compatible with all operating systems or laptop models.

Important Considerations and Troubleshooting

Compatibility is paramount. Not all laptops are designed to be used as external monitors. Most laptops only have HDMI output ports, meaning they are designed to send video signals, not receive them. Make sure you can successfully implement one of the methods mentioned above. Check the ports on your laptop before attempting any of these methods.

Latency, the delay between an action on your main computer and its appearance on the laptop screen, can be a significant issue, particularly for gaming or video editing. To minimize latency, use a wired connection whenever possible, close unnecessary applications on both computers, and ensure your drivers are up-to-date.

Display resolution and refresh rate are important factors for visual clarity and smoothness. Adjust the resolution and refresh rate settings on your main computer to match the capabilities of your laptop’s display. Be aware of the limitations of your laptop’s screen; it may not support high resolutions or refresh rates.

Audio management is another key consideration. You may need to configure your audio output settings to direct sound to the appropriate device (either your main computer or your laptop).

Security is crucial, especially when using Remote Desktop or screen sharing apps. Use strong passwords, enable Network Level Authentication (NLA) for Remote Desktop, and be cautious about granting permissions to unknown applications.

Troubleshooting common issues such as connectivity problems, display issues (like a black screen or incorrect resolution), and performance problems (lag or stuttering) may be necessary. If you experience connectivity problems, check your network connection, firewalls, and antivirus software. For display issues, verify your resolution settings and driver compatibility. For performance problems, close unnecessary applications, upgrade your hardware if possible, and consider using a wired connection.

Alternative Solutions

While using a laptop as a monitor is a viable option, dedicated portable monitors offer another compelling solution. These monitors are specifically designed to be lightweight, compact, and easy to connect to your computer via USB-C or HDMI. They often offer better image quality and features compared to repurposing a laptop, but they come at a higher cost.
